Syria's Uncertain Future Under HTS Leadership
Following the fall of Bashar al-Assad's regime after a 13-year war, Ahmed al-Shara of Hayat Tahrir al-Sham (HTS) leads Syria, facing challenges including internal conflicts, international sanctions, and regional power dynamics.

China's 2025 Challenges: Trade Wars, Tech Competition, and Geopolitical Risks
China faces multiple economic and geopolitical challenges in 2025, including escalating trade conflicts with the US and EU, technological competition, strained relations due to its alliance with Russia, and instability in the Middle East.

Two-State Solution Faces Major Setbacks Amidst Shifting Political Realities
Germany's continued support for a two-state solution faces challenges due to Israel's illegal settlements in the West Bank and declining support among both Israelis and Palestinians, who increasingly favor alternative solutions like a confederation.

Three Israelis Killed in West Bank Shooting Attack
On Monday, a shooting attack near the Israeli settlement of Kedumim killed three Israelis and injured eight; two Palestinian gunmen opened fire on cars and a bus before fleeing, amidst the ongoing war in Gaza and increased tensions in the West Bank.

Jenin Camp Clashes: 13 Dead Amid Palestinian Infighting
Clashes between Palestinian Authority forces and armed groups in Jenin refugee camp have resulted in at least 13 deaths, including a 21-year-old journalism student, amid accusations of Iranian funding and Israeli involvement, highlighting the complex political dynamics of the West Bank.

Syrian Female Journalists: Courage Under Fire
From 2011, Syrian female journalists risked their lives to report on the conflict, facing arrest, kidnapping, and death at the hands of various groups, including the Syrian regime, the PYD, and ISIS; at least seven were killed, while others worked under pseudonyms to protect their families.
